Abstract

A Gram-stain-negative, aerobic, yellow-pigmented, flexirubin-negative, rod-shaped, non-motile and psychrophilic bacterial strain, PAMC 27237, was isolated from marine sediment of the Ross Sea, Antarctica. Strain PAMC 27237 grew at 0–20 °C (optimally at 17 °C), at pH 5.0–9.5 (optimally at pH 7.0) and in the presence of 0–3.5 % (w/v) NaCl (optimally at 1.5–2.5 %). The major fatty acids (≥5 %) were iso-C 3-OH, C 2-OH, anteiso-C, summed feature 3 (Cω6/Cω7c), iso-C 3-OH, anteiso-Cω9, anteiso-C A, iso-C 3-OH and iso-C G. The major polar lipids were phosphatidylethanolamine, two unidentified aminolipids, four unidentified lipids and a glycolipid. The major respiratory quinone was MK-6. Phylogenetic analysis based on the 16S rRNA gene sequence revealed that strain PAMC 27237 belongs to the genus showing high similarities with the type strains of (97.2 %), (97.0 %) and (96.4 %). Average nucleotide identity values between strain PAMC 27237 and the type strains of and were 83.1 and 84.2 %, respectively, and mean genome-to-genome distances were 22.4–24.2 %, indicating that strain PAMC 27237 is clearly distinguished from the most closely related species of the genus . The genomic DNA G+C content calculated from genome sequences was 33.5 mol%. Based on the phenotypic, chemotaxonomic and phylogenetic data presented, strain PAMC 27237 is considered to represent a novel species of the genus , for which the name sp. nov. is proposed. The type strain is PAMC 27237 ( = KCTC 42130 = JCM 30370).
